Random facts:
(1)Crossing the border from the Republic of Ireland to Northern Ireland has no checkpoints.
It is no different than crossing from Pennsylvania into Ohio.
Different country....different currency...but no one cares. Just keep driving
*
The English Language is the same....OR IS IT? 🤔 😄
USA the back of the car is the "trunk"......in Ireland it is the "BOOT"
*
USA.....if you are in the hotel lobby and you walk up the stairs one level you reach the second floor.
Ireland: The lobby level is the GROUND FLOOR....if you walk up the stairs one level you are on the FIRST FLOOR.
*
In the USA I wear "sneakers".......in Ireland they call those "Runners"
*
In North America if someone said: "Today I saw a JUMPER" ... you might conclude the speaker saw someone about to commit suicide from a tall building or a bridge.
In Ireland, a JUMPER is what we call the winter garment : SWEATER
*
In North America we have "POLICE"......in Ireland they have "GARDA"
*
In the USA we have parking lots.......in Ireland they have CAR PARKS
*
In Ireland we will never "stand in a line" ......in Ireland we will "get in a QUEUE"
*
